MRPL diversifies crude sourcing to strengthen supply security amid geopolitical risks

Mangalore Refinery and Petrochemicals Ltd (MRPL) has diversified its crude oil sourcing to 273 grades from Asia, South America, Africa, the US and Russia, processing new crudes like Hout, Mostarda, Gindungo and Sarir Mesla. The strategy, detailed in MRPL's 2025-26 annual report, aims to reduce dependency on any single source and enhance supply security amid geopolitical tensions, particularly around the Strait of Hormuz. MRPL also collaborated with Indian Strategic Petroleum Reserves Ltd to utilize underground storage for crude inventory management.

MRPL becomes first Indian state refiner to charter Iraqi crude cargo since Hormuz blockade

Mangalore Refinery and Petrochemicals Ltd (MRPL) has chartered the Aframax tanker Jasmin Joy to load crude oil from Iraq's Basrah oil terminal on July 19-20, becoming the first Indian state-owned refiner to secure a west-of-Hormuz cargo since the Strait of Hormuz partially reopened after disruptions from the Israel-Iran conflict. The move highlights ongoing shipping challenges for Indian state refiners. MRPL operates a 300,000 barrel-per-day refinery in Karnataka.

Beyond Hormuz: What HPCL Rajasthan Refinery Limited Inaugurated by PM Modi Means for India's Energy Security

Prime Minister Narendra Modi inaugurated the HPCL Rajasthan Refinery Limited (HRRL) in Pachpadra, India's first greenfield integrated refinery-cum-petrochemical complex. The project, part of a Rs 1.06 lakh crore infrastructure push, aims to reduce India's vulnerability to supply disruptions highlighted by the recent Strait of Hormuz crisis. Union Minister Hardeep Singh Puri noted India's refining capacity will rise from 270 MMTPA to 310-320 MMTPA by 2030, contrasting with declining capacity in the US and Europe.

BPCL to shut crude units at Mumbai refinery in September for routine maintenance

Bharat Petroleum Corporation (BPCL) plans to shut a 120,000 barrels per day crude unit and secondary units at its 200,000 bpd Mumbai refinery for three to four weeks in September and October for routine maintenance, according to an industry source. The shutdown was originally scheduled for June but was delayed to meet local fuel demand.
